background preloader

Odysseylimo

Facebook Twitter

Odyssey Limousine

Odyssey Limousine offers premium chauffeured transportation services, both locally and internationally. | Address: 5739 Kanan Rd, Agoura Hills, CA 91301, United States | Phone Number: (818) 401-2999 | Email: info@odysseylimo.com | Website: